# MySQL非root账号安装指南
MySQL是一种流行的关系数据库管理系统。对于大多数开发者和DBA(数据库管理员)来说,他们可能没有权限以root用户身份安装软件。这篇文章将介绍如何使用非root账号在Linux系统上安装MySQL,并包含代码示例、流程图和饼状图。
## 前期准备
在开始之前,请确保以下事项:
1. 你有一个非root用户的SSH访问权限。
2. 系统已经安装了必要
# MySQL 非 Root 账号启动的详细指南
在使用 MySQL 数据库时,通常我们会使用 root 账号进行管理和操作。然而,在某些情况下,为了安全和权限管理,可能需要使用非 root 账号来启动 MySQL 服务器。本文将介绍如何使用非 root 账号启动 MySQL,并提供相应的代码示例。同时,我们还将通过流程图和类图来帮助更好地理解这一过程。
## 1. 理解 MySQL 账户权限
## MYSQL 非ROOT账号启动
在MYSQL数据库中,通常我们会使用ROOT账号来启动数据库服务。但有时候为了安全考虑,我们希望使用一个非ROOT账号来启动MYSQL服务。本文将介绍如何使用非ROOT账号来启动MYSQL数据库服务,并提供相应的代码示例。
### 为什么要使用非ROOT账号启动MYSQL
使用ROOT账号来启动MYSQL服务存在一定的安全风险,因为ROOT账号具有最高权
原创
2024-07-03 06:43:09
109阅读
# 如何以非 root 用户启动 MySQL
在许多生产环境中,出于安全考虑,推荐使用非 root 用户启动 MySQL。本文将指导你通过一系列步骤来实现这一目标,包括必要的代码和命令,同时使用表格、饼状图和状态图形式展现整个流程。
## 流程概述
下面的表格总结了以非 root 用户启动 MySQL 的步骤:
| 步骤 | 操作 |
原创
2024-11-01 06:51:22
214阅读
详细的redis安装步骤可参考我的另一篇文章:http://meiling.blog.51cto.com/6220221/19791561、普通用户安装redis[centos6@localhost ~]$ tar -xfredis-4.0.2.tar.gz
[centos6@localhost ~]$ cd redis-4.0.2
转载
2024-06-29 14:04:29
120阅读
目录背景问题描述原因分析解决方案解决步骤背景 某个客户现场需要安装、部署nginx,可是客户不给root用户,也不给root权限,只给了p05_dev普通用户。 因此安装nginx的时候,需要将nginx安装到用
# MySQL 非root用户安装指南
MySQL 是一种流行的开源关系数据库管理系统,适用于各种应用场景。虽然通常用户以 root 权限安装 MySQL,但在某些场合(如共享服务器或个人电脑)中,非 root 用户进行安装更为合适。本文将详细介绍如何在非 root 用户环境下安装 MySQL,并提供相关代码示例。
## 安装 MySQL 的流程
在非 root 环境下安装 MySQL 的过
原创
2024-10-23 03:15:31
62阅读
# 非root权限安装MySQL指南
在这一篇文章中,我们将学习如何非root权限下安装MySQL。在许多情况下,用户没有足够的权限去全局安装MySQL,但我们可以通过一些技巧和步骤在本地用户目录下完成安装。下面是整个过程的大致步骤和详细说明。
## 流程概述
以下是非root安装MySQL的基本流程:
| 步骤 | 描述 |
|------|-
在某些情况下,用户可能没有足够的权限以 `root` 身份在其系统上安装 MySQL。我的这篇文章将引导你了解如何进行“非root安装MySQL”的步骤,包括环境准备、配置、验证和优化等方面。
### 环境准备
在安装 MySQL 之前,我们需要确保系统中已经安装好相应的依赖。以下是一些基本的依赖包:
- `gcc`
- `make`
- `cmake`
- `libaio`
- `ncur
Linux下,非root用户安装及配置mysql参考链接下载安装包解压及编写配置文件解压文件编写配置文件安装MySql启动与关闭MySql服务启动关闭查看MySql进程状态登录MySql获取root用户密码MySql正常登录命令报错使用mysql.sock登录(有root权限)登录mysql(有root权限)。我里我以root身份登录.登录后要退出的话修改初始密码创建一个数据库授予用户该数据库权
转载
2024-08-07 14:09:24
79阅读
虽然说是非root权限,但是编译php所需要的依赖包还是需要root权限的。 安装之前先保证linux有gcc和g++,因为很多东西都需要这两个库,如果没有,运行以下命令 yum install -y gcc gcc-c++ 一般linux里面都会有,如果已经存在,它会报已经存在无法安装一、安装nginx 1. 安装nginx前,我们需要安装3个依赖包zlib、pcre、openssl
转载
2023-11-26 17:35:42
16阅读
[转载]Linux下非root用户如何安装软件这是本人遇到的实际问题,之前用到的所有机器,无论是自己的PC还是云服务器,root权限都是妥妥的,但是现在发现实验室的服务器原来自己并没有root权限2333再看用户的权限。root用户是bug,电脑上所有的文件都是它的,权限位设置对其无效。非root用户默认 只对家目录有完全的控制权限,对/tmp目录有读写的权限。/tmp目录如其名,应该只在其中存放
转载
2024-02-05 11:21:19
219阅读
本章我们将介绍 MySQL 数据库管理系统的安装,我们将在 Linux 上安装 MySQL。我们有几种方法可以在系统上安装 MySQL。 我们可以从软件包,二进制文件或源代码中安装 MySQL。从软件包安装 MySQL安装 MySQL 的最简单方法是通过软件包系统。在 Ubuntu 和其他基于 Debian 的发行版上,我们可以使用apt-get工具轻松地从软件包中安装 MySQL。 此命令将安装
转载
2023-09-29 21:17:24
194阅读
# MySQL RPM 非Root安装指南
在许多开发环境中,使用MySQL数据库是必不可少的。然而,通常需要root权限来安装软件,这让一些非root用户望而却步。本文将介绍如何在没有root权限的情况下通过RPM包安装MySQL,并提供相应的代码示例和图示化流程。
## 前提条件
- 用户必须在Linux系统(如CentOS或RHEL)上。
- 确保拥有wget或curl来下载files
原创
2024-09-17 05:18:24
228阅读
# 非root用户安装MySQL的步骤指南
在本篇文章中,我们将学习如何在非root用户的环境中安装MySQL。虽然非root权限通常会对软件安装带来一些限制,但通过一些技巧,我们仍能顺利完成这个过程。下面我们将详细说明整个过程,并提供必要的代码和解释。
## 1. 流程概览
为了确保你能清晰地理解整个过程,我们将整个步骤概括如下:
| 步骤 | 描述 |
原创
2024-09-07 06:35:15
73阅读
要在没有 root 权限的情况下安装 MySQL,尤其是在共享主机或限制多的系统上,我们需要采取一些特别的步骤。接下来,我将分享解决“非 root 权限安装 MySQL”问题的过程,涵盖环境准备、分步指南、配置详解、验证测试、排错指南和扩展应用。
## 环境准备
在开始之前,我们需要确保已经准备好以下依赖:
- **依赖软件**:
- `wget`、`tar`(通常已预安装)
一、数据库安装及管理1. 安装需安装mysql客户端和服务器端。Centos下,可用命令:yum install mysql安装mysql客户端;使用命令:yum install mysql-server安装mysql服务器端。2. 启动命令:rpm -q mysql 可用于查询机器上是否安装了mysql客户端命令:/etc/rc.d/init.d/mysqld start或service mys
实现“MySQL非root账号查看用户权限命令”的过程如下:
步骤 | 操作
---|---
1 | 连接到MySQL服务器
2 | 创建一个新的数据库用户
3 | 授予新用户查询权限
4 | 使用新用户登录MySQL服务器
5 | 查看用户权限
具体步骤如下:
### 1. 连接到MySQL服务器
首先,你需要连接到MySQL服务器。可以使用以下命令:
```
mysql -u roo
原创
2024-01-15 06:32:50
109阅读
在现代开发环境中,许多开发者可能没有使用root权限的机会。团队中可能会出现需要在非root帐号下安装MySQL的情况,这里将详细记录如何解决“非root帐号安装MySQL”的问题,涵盖从环境准备到扩展应用的全过程。
## 环境准备
### 软硬件要求
- **操作系统**: Linux (如Ubuntu, CentOS等)
- **内存**: 至少1 GB
- **处理器**: 1个CPU核
在这里,我们将探讨如何在非root用户权限下安装MySQL。这种情况在某些环境下可能会遇到,比如云服务器或共享主机,它们通常不允许用户获取root权限。在接下来的讨论中,我们将逐步介绍所需的环境准备、操作步骤、具体配置、验证测试、优化技巧和排错指南。
## 环境准备
在开始之前,确保你的系统满足以下软硬件要求:
- **操作系统**:支持Linux(如Ubuntu、CentOS等)或Wind